After disappearing for nearly a century, THE DAUGHTER OF DAWN returns to once again break boundaries for Native American cinema. An all-Indigenous cast directed by Norbert Myles tell the story of a love triangle amidst rising conflict between Kiowa and Comanche villages, featuring thrilling fight scenes, dance performances and more. Four sets of brothers - David, Keith, and Robert Carradine; James and Stacy Keach; Randy and Dennis Quaid; Christopher and Nicholas Guest - depict real-life siblings in this emotionally charged portrayal of the Old West's legendary bandits. The notorious James-Younger gang is the most famous group of outlaws in the country. 49-17 is a charming and suspenseful western parody about a millionaire who hires a Wild West theatrical troupe to relive his past as a miner forty niner. Every sacred western cow is turned on its ear: the patriarchal representative of the law, the Young Man, the Gambler, the saloon brawl, and the Woman.
